Introduction
Salvador Dali's painting, Spain, is a quintessential example of surrealist art. Created in 1938, this oil on canvas piece measures 91 x 60 cm and is a testament to Dali's unique blend of the bizarre and the beautiful.The Painting
The image depicts a man lying on the ground with his head in a box, surrounded by a pile of bones. The atmosphere is dark and mysterious, evoking a sense of danger or unease. Several other figures are scattered throughout the scene, some standing and others sitting. A knife lies near the man's head, while another knife is located further away. Two birds are also visible, one perched above the man and the other flying nearby.Symbolism and Interpretation
Dali was known for his use of symbolism in his paintings, and Spain is no exception. The man with his head in a box can be seen as a representation of the Spanish people during the Civil War, which was ongoing at the time of the painting's creation. The bones surrounding him symbolize death and destruction, while the knives represent violence and conflict. The birds may signify freedom or escape from the chaos.Artistic Style
Dali's surrealist style is characterized by dream-like imagery and a blend of reality and fantasy. In Spain, he uses bold colors and sharp lines to create a sense of tension and unease. The painting's composition is carefully balanced, with each element working together to convey the artist's message.Context and Influence
